The food was also great this week.  Another successful Gluten Free trip in the books.  It is possible to travel and eat safe Gluten Free food guys.  I promise!  We did follow the meal plan and cook most of our meals in our condos.  This helps so much with budgets, cross contamination and having safe food.  For our big family dinners I just made the whole meal Gluten Free.  The other 8 Gluten-eaters didn’t complain and cleaned their plates.  We did eat out 2 nights at restaurants and I will share about those in a different post.
